English Conversation Groups provide a safe space for Belmont neighbors with foundational English skills to practice speaking aloud with other learners, socialize, and learn about American culture. The Belmont Public Library is able to offer these opportunities thanks to our generous and dedicated volunteers. 

Frequently Asked Questions:

  • How do volunteers lead these groups?
    • Volunteers guide the conversation in many ways: Providing conversation starters, planning activities using free resources, setting and maintaining a welcoming atmosphere, and gently correcting mis-spoken English.
    • Volunteers can also help support each other by sharing resources, offering to substitute-lead groups in a pinch, and checking in regularly.
    • Volunteers are Never expected to spend their own money in the course of volunteering. This includes printing and copying handouts.
  • Is there a curriculum? 
    • There is no set curriculum. There are resources for starting conversations, setting group norms, and suggested best practices, but these groups are less formal than a traditional class and the volunteer leader has a lot of freedom to try new things.
  • How many people may be in a group?
    • Traditionally, the groups are capped at 7 participants. But there is flexibility if the volunteer leader is comfortable with larger groups. 
    • The small size is partially to account for varied levels of English fluency, as we do not assess patrons when they register. 
  • Do participants expect to receive grammar lessons? Is there a certificate of completion?
    • As this is not a class, all participants are expected to have a foundation of English skills.
